What happened
Variety has released its predictions for the media landscape in 2026, highlighting several key developments. Among these, Christopher Nolan's film "The Odyssey" is anticipated to be the year's biggest hit. Additionally, the predictions touch on a significant deal between Netflix and Warner Bros., as well as potential challenges facing Disney.

Background & context
Variety is a well-known publication in the entertainment industry, often providing insights and predictions about upcoming trends and events. Christopher Nolan is a renowned filmmaker, known for his work on films such as "Inception" and "Dunkirk." His projects often generate significant anticipation and box office success, making "The Odyssey" a highly anticipated release. Netflix and Warner Bros. are major players in the media and entertainment sectors. Netflix, a leading streaming service, has transformed how audiences consume content, while Warner Bros., a historic film studio, has a vast library of content and production capabilities. Their partnership could reshape content distribution and production strategies, influencing the competitive streaming market.
